Output 15894d59e26e06be745518722ad6b22048b1da705d5b34d013b2522fa80990a1:0

value
8905000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2e4ab74ca64707522804e8f6b7e7d80619c64f83 OP_EQUALVERIFY OP_CHECKSIG
address
15DmbBfMiVkV2rog6P4xMr3NPuhpTNAMS9
transaction
15894d59e26e06be745518722ad6b22048b1da705d5b34d013b2522fa80990a1
spent
true